Lane's Arabic-English Lexicon

مُرَاضَعٌ

Root: رضع

Full Definition

مُرَاضَعٌ : see رَضِيعٌ.
2 Also An unborn child of a woman who is suckling another child: such a child proves to be meagre in body, slender in the bones, and ill nourished.
